Palworld Mounts – How to unlock mounts

If you want to get from point A to point B quicker in Palworld, you will want a mount. Sure, you can run around on foot, but things are much easier when you can command a Pal to move for you. That is why it is important to know how to unlock mounts and ride them.

There are multiple Pals that can be used as mounts. For instance, you can use Melpaca earlier on in the game to quickly get around the map. Doing so also unlocks the abilities Fluffy Tackle and Air Cannon. Of course, it helps if you know how to catch Pals. This guide will show you how to unlock mounts in Palworld. How to unlock and ride mounts in Palworld

In Palworld, certain Pals can be used as mounts. These are typically equestrian-style Pals like Melpaca or Eikthyrdeer. You can also ride Pals such as Grizzbolt and Jetragon. To unlock these mounts, you must first catch one of these Pals. Doing so will unlock the ability to craft a saddle. Note that you need to be a specific level to unlock and craft certain saddles.

Saddles can be built at a Pal Gear Workbench. Once you build a saddle, it will unlock the mount ability for the Pal you build the saddle for. For instance, a Melpaca Saddle will allow you to ride Melpaca.

Now that you have a saddle made, summon your Pal, walk up to it, and interact with it using the X button or the F key. This will allow you to hop onto your Pal and ride it around. While riding a Pal, you can use ranged weapons such as bows and guns. You can also use the Pal’s abilities. For example, while riding Melpaca, you can use the Air Cannon ability to attack other Pals.
